  1. 4 Simple Tips to Cure a Mouth Sore

  2. Mouth sores are incredibly painful and can make it difficult to speak, eat, or drink. In this presentation, we’ll provide you with some tips that will help your mouth sore heal faster so that you can get back to your life pain-free!

  3. 1. Salt Rinse Rinsing your canker sore with a cup of lukewarm salt water for 30 seconds will help disinfect the area and speed up healing.

  4. 2. Hydrogen Peroxide Rinse Hydrogen peroxide rinse is an effective way to reduce canker sore pain and expedite healing.

  5. 3. Nutritious Food When you have a cold sore, eating healthy can help equip your immune system with the tools it needs to fight off the virus.

  6. 4. Glycine Cream Applying this cream to cold sores as soon as they start developing can help speed up the healing process.
